Delivery mechanism, fixing device and image forming apparatus
Abstract
A sheet delivery mechanism including: a first roll; a second roll; and a plurality of convexes formed circumferentially for pushing a rear end of a sheet to be delivered, wherein: a sheet delivery roll pair comprises the first roll and the second roll in contact with each other; at least one of the first roll and the second roll is provided with the plurality of convexes; and one of the plurality of convexes is arranged to be more inside radially than the tangential line drawn from the radial tip of another convex upstream adjacent in the rotating direction to the one convex at issue to the outer periphery of the roll.

4 . A sheet delivery mechanism comprising:
a first roll; a second roll; and a plurality of convexes formed circumferentially for pushing the rear end of a sheet to be delivered to shift inwardly in the radial direction through their elastic deformation, wherein a sheet delivery roll pair comprises the first roll and the second roll in contact with each other; at least one of the first roll and the second roll is provided with the plurality of convexes on its roll body; where a sheet which receives pressure not lower than a predetermined pressure when it passes a nip passes the nip, the convex passing the same position as the nip in the rotating direction shifts inwardly in the radial direction; and where the sheet which receives the pressure lower than the predetermined pressure when it passes the nip passes the nip, the convex keeps its normal convex shape.
5 . The sheet delivery mechanism according to claim 4 , wherein
the roll body and the convexes are integrally formed of resin, and the convexes are formed in a lightening shape or a shape with recesses on both ends in the axial direction
6 . The sheet delivery mechanism according to claim 4 , wherein
the roll body and the convexes are formed separately from each other and made of different materials from each other
7 . The sheet delivery mechanism according to claim 6 , wherein
the roll body comprises at least one of a tetrafluoroethylene-perfluoroalkylvinylether copolymer, a polytetrafluoroethylene and a tetrafluoroethylene-ethylene copolymer.
8 . The sheet delivery mechanism according to claim 6 , wherein
the convexes comprises at least one of a polyacetal, a polypropylene and a polycarbonate.
